I Never Walked Alone: the Autobiography of an American Singer - Book Review

Ebony,  August, 2003  

> (Wiley, $30.00) by Shirley Verrett with Christopher Brooks is a rich and detailed look at the life of one of the most celebrated sopranos of the late 20th century. Once hailed as "The Black Callas," Shirley Verrett details a dazzling career and personal life of operatic highs and lows. She currently lives in Ann Arbor, Mich., and is the James Earl Jones Distinguished Professor of Voice at the University of Michigan.
